## Auth

Quick note for release: the Wavelet preview service won't generate waveform thumbnails unless the build pipeline is authenticated. Anonymous calls get a 401 and the release job just hangs, which is annoying. Set the auth header before kicking off the render step. For the current release cycle, use the bearer token below.

portal login ticket: eyJhbGciOiJIUzI1NiIsInR5cCI6IkpXVCJ9.eyJzdWIiOiIMjvRAf3PEFIn0.nuv9gjixLtnr

The ProctorQueue endpoint in Examline's scheduling service accepts POST requests to enqueue candidates awaiting live proctor assignment. Each request must include the session token, exam window, and priority tier; the queue drains in strict FIFO order unless an accommodation flag is present. Rate limits apply per tenant, and retries should use exponential backoff to avoid duplicate enqueues. Release builds must be validated against the staging queue before cutover. All calls to staging authenticate using the key below.

gateway credential: kto3_qfe

Runbook: FleetGauge Fuel-Usage Report

If the nightly fuel-usage report fails to generate, first confirm the Hauler depot feed is current, then rerun the aggregation job from the OdoSync dashboard. The job posts results to the internal metrics service, which requires authentication on every request. Use the service key below when rerunning manually.

gateway credential: zpat15_lMLOSdhT94y0U3l